ZIP 50603 and ZIP 50613 are ZIP Code areas in Iowa. This page compares them across population, income, housing, education, commuting, and how each has changed since 2019.

ZIP 50613 has the higher population (43,680 vs 410 in ZIP 50603). ZIP 50613 has the higher median household income ($75,642 vs $62,667 in ZIP 50603). ZIP 50613 has the higher median home value ($258,300 vs $97,000 in ZIP 50603).
